Maki Ohguro (?? ?? ?guro Maki?) (born 31 December 1969) is a Japanese pop singer and songwriter. She is from Sapporo in Hokkaid?. In 1989, she passed the '3rd BAD' audition. Her famous songs are "DA?KA?RA", "Chotto", and so on... Her second single "DA?ka?RA" sold 1.1 million copies and won the 'Japan Record Grand Prix' newcomer award of the year. Because of her rare public appearances, she was originally known as a phantom singer, like Izumi Sakai of Zard. "Anata Dake Mitsumeteru", the ending theme for Slam Dunk, was the number 2 song for the month of January 1994, and is certified as a Million record, selling 1,087,160 copies.
